First Turnout is a soundside spot on Hatteras Island, the first roadside turnout along NC Highway 12 when arriving from the north toward Avon. Parking is roadside with direct access to Pamlico Sound. The water is very shallow and flat, perfect for learning and freestyle. It's a convenient and quick sound access, popular with kitesurfers passing along the road between spots.
Flat water on Pamlico Sound — ideal conditions for learning and freestyle. Very shallow for a long distance. Sandy bottom. Water is warm in summer. Large body of water with plenty of space. Predictable and consistent conditions.

Stingrays — do the stingray shuffle. Sea nettles (jellyfish) in summer. Oyster shells possible — water shoes recommended. Proximity to NC Highway 12 — careful with gear transport. Violent afternoon thunderstorms possible in summer.
